The Ministry of Education and Sports is considering extending a system that allows young but over-age school dropouts to return to formal education.
The initiative, already operating in refugee-hosting districts under War Child Canada, could soon be available to Ugandans outside the refugee communities through the Accelerated Education Programme.
Speaking at the launch of the Accelerated Education Programme Guidelines for Uganda, Sarah Bugoosi Kibooli, the Commissioner for Special Needs Education, said the programme has in the last two years, demonstrated that it can rapidly improve literacy among beneficiaries.

The programme, implemented under the Bridge Programme spearheaded by War Child Canada, is supported by the MasterCard Foundation with partners including Save the Children, Norwegian Refugee Council, Finn Church Aid and Windle International. End
